2013 QAR to TJS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the QAR to TJS ex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 17, valuing the pair at 1.3120.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on October 10, dropping to 1.3048.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0072 TJS.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.3084 to the December average rate of 1.3110, the exchange rate registered a net change of 0.20%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 1.3120 was down 3.59% compared to the 2012 peak of 1.3608,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 1.3101 1.3075 1.3084
February 1.3101 1.3056 1.3068
March 1.3120 1.3056 1.3061
April 1.3091 1.3053 1.3074
May 1.3103 1.3060 1.3067
June 1.3088 1.3057 1.3072
July 1.3101 1.3076 1.3093
August 1.3107 1.3089 1.3093
September 1.3109 1.3089 1.3097
October 1.3109 1.3048 1.3098
November 1.3110 1.3105 1.3107
December 1.3115 1.3105 1.3110
